I am putting the finishing touches on some custom uniforms. Once that is complete and I get 4th down plays working to my satisfaction, I will begin a new 12 team, 11 man league (100 yard NFL type field) with the following rules: No punts (almost have this working well) Unlimited motion (no plays in playbook yet to take advantage of this rule) live field goals 2pt conversions loose penalties 12 minute quarters 40 second play clock 12 teams in the following structure: North Division Baltimore Stars Chicago Enforcers New York Knights Toronto Towers Southeast Division Birmingham Stallions Miami Marauders Orlando Rage San Antonio Defenders West Division Las Vegas Outlaws Los Angeles Sharks Oakland Invaders Portland Storm The current league schedule idea is to play a 13 game season playing each division opponent 3 times and four other division opponents once. The division winners plus a wildcard team will compete in the playoffs. The schedue would be modified each offseason to change the out of division opponents (unless the game can do this on its own).
